My sweet Aunt Myrtle (deceased Jan 2007) had glacoma, scarry thought losing your eye sight so she kept up with all eye appts. for sure.  One I will remember 4 ever!! Mid June 2003, She was to have surgery for the glacoma and cataracts. The night before the surgery I had her spend the night with me here in Alba. She was not in the habit of spending the night away from home so this was going to be an adventure. She packed her overnight case and away we came to my house.  So much different than hers. She reminded me of how cold I keep my house 100 times in the course of the day, I finally kicked it up to 78 so I would not freeze her to death and gave her my heaviest quilt for the night.   We watched a little TV and she was ready for bed at 830.  June at 830 is still daylight, I get her all bedded down without an electric blanket and she wants a flashlight in case she has to go out (this means pee) So I tried to show her the lamp beside the bed and she just wanted a flashlight.. she didn't think about packing hers.., maybe she would be okay.. she went on and on about the flashlight, I know she was a little nervous but shit.. so .....yep you guessed it.. I found her a flashlight!! Okay here we go..... Kent leaves early for work and always has, well she was up sitting in the kitchen, scarred him to death, not used to people sitting in the kitchen at 400 in the morn, so he wished her well and off he went. Aunt Myrts appt was at 930 in Tyler which is about 45 mins from our house, but we would need to leave early in case......in case of what I never knew...So I got up early too and fixed her breakfast, she told me exactly what she wanted and I enjoyed fixing my Great Aunt's breakfast.     1 sausage, 1 egg over easy not to runny, 1 piece dry toast, 1 cup of coffee.  Nothing more nothing less.  I had the exact meal. I now know why she was so skinny all her life.  (the lack of food is the secret) got the house in order as she would say and then got on the rode early for the surgery, every thing went as expected. They wanted to see her bright and early the next morning. So I thought we will just go get her some more clothes and back to my house....WRONG!!! She wanted to go home.  I could not let her stay by herself after the eye surgery, we had a list of drops, pills, and every pill had a different time to take and a one drop in the left eye 2 in the right take a pill hold head back...Lord it was going to take a nursing staff to do all that, SO I got my clothes and spent the night with My Great Aunt. in a 100 yr old house with no A/C. 
It was going to be a really loooooonnnnnnngggggg nite..I asked her if she had a fan, she did have a fan, she would have to get it out of the closet. Lord.  She brings out this pristine 1940 something model General Electric oscillating fan in the original box. Me: Does it work?? Her: It did the last time I used it. Me: when was that? Her: Can't remember. Lordy. Just sitting in her kitchen watching TV with her I have broke a sweat a middle linebacker would be proud of. She never plugged in the fan.  Her: Well it is 830 time for bed. Me: What? I have just finished dosing her will all the meds and flushing her eyes with drops and now we just go to bed.. At this point I tell her: Aunt Myrtle I am melting!  Can I take a shower to cool off before I go to bed? She reminds me it's only Thursday?! Me: It not about the hygenie its about survival. If I don't cool off before I go to bed I will burst into flames. She allows me to take a shower, I thank her from the bottom of my thermostat. I normally don't sleep in to many clothes, but some how I knew this would not fly well with Myrt so I get out of a cool shower only to put on a tshirt and underwear.  I sneak my wash rag to bed with me so I can cover my face, or I should say eyebrow.  (it was a rag, tiny little rag to wash my fat body with) I get to sleep in Aunt Lilly's room, this is where I will bake for the nite, and   THE FAN IS ON!! Hell to the yes!!! WAIT.......the bed is on the far side of the room. the only electric plug is on the opposite side of the room with a 2 foot cord.  Only 1 speed on the fan! Jesus Christ.  NO AUNT MYRTLE I DON'T NEED A BLANKET!!!!!!  but thanks for asking.  I am her guest so it would not be good to drag the bed over closer to the fan, I am thinking about sleeping in the floor with my nose/head/body within inches of the scarriest fan you have ever seen.  Machetie looking blades, and I would turn over and slice my ear off...No I will make this work....1 Oscillating fan, 1 speed, SLOW, seemed liked 50 feet away, sundown barely and it was 99 degrees in the house.  She is snoring I peek in on her, she is under a sheet and light blanket, the windows are open and not a breath of air is stirring the curtains.  Holy Mother of God.  I will surely parish in this heat.
I am miserable.  About ever 10 turns of the fan I feel a wisp of air A Wisp of Air!! My little eyebrow rag is trying so hard to comfort me..................Sweet Jesus, is that Aunt Myrtle cooking breakfast already??? I am exhausted I truly melted, my tshirt, underwear and sheets are soaking wet, and she has the burners on cooking breakfast. me:   Hey, Aunt Myrtle, I will buy you a donut on the way to the dr. office?  Just give me a few minutes and I................Her: Breakfast is ready.. 1 sausage, 1 egg, 1 piece of dry toast and 1 cup of HOT coffee.......Me:  thank you be there in a minute.  Her: Be sure and put that fan away I won't be using it.
Me: Yes Ma'am!
